This NIC is sent some Ethernet frame, but frame size is wrong. When I run the "ping" command, % ping -c 1 -s 18 192.168.1.1 output packet size is 68bytes. Perhaps,... Ethernet header + IP header + ICMP header + ICMP data + (4) + FCS = 68byte >How-To-Repeat: If you send a packet that size is larger than 64bytes and smaller then 68bytes, Output packet size is 68byte. >Fix: In "/usr/src/sys/i386/isa/if_lnc.c", In function "lnc_start()", desc->md->md2 = -max(len, ETHER_MIN_LEN); this line is mismatch. I think, correct routine is next line. desc->md->md2 = -max(len, ETHER_MIN_LEN - ETHER_CRC_LEN); >Audit-Trail: >Unformatted: To Unsubscribe: send mail to majordomo@FreeBSD.org with "unsubscribe freebsd-bugs" in the body of the message
